Capacity note for the Bramblewick export retry queue. Failed exports are requeued with exponential backoff, and the queue depth is our main capacity signal: sustained depth above the high-water mark means downstream Pellis storage is saturated, not that we need more workers. As the new contractor, please don't raise worker counts without checking storage latency first — it usually makes things worse. Retry timing, backoff caps, and the high-water threshold are all driven by the constants shown below.

limits module of yagef-bajog:
TIERS = {
    "druael": 370,
    "tamix": 286,
    "pelius": 541,
    "pelael": 78,
    "pelox": 47,
    "ralath": 533,
    "drumir": 801,
}

## Runbook: WebSocket Compression Rollout — Driftline Gateway

Support note: enabling permessage compression on Driftline reduces bandwidth roughly 40% but adds CPU load and can increase tail latency for small frames. If customers report lag after this release, compression is the first thing to check. The toggle ships as a signed config push; verification requires the current deploy key, which follows below.

deploy key for yajop-fahop: bky3_h1v

Leadership Review Briefing — Tessmark Holdings

Quick update for the board: the sale of our Ferrow Analytics unit is on track. Buyer diligence wraps next month, and staff briefings are scheduled. Proceeds earmarked for debt reduction and the Northvale build-out.

One item we're keeping off the main deck — the detail sits in the note just below.

confidential, bahof-yaweg: Headcount on the Kaseth team goes from 32 to 109 by the end of January. Gross margin on Kaseth came in at 46 percent against a plan of 45 percent.